    Uddhav Thackeray victim of betrayal: Swami Avimukteshwaranand Saraswati

    Swami Avimukteshwaranand Saraswati, the Shankaracharya of the Jyotish Peeth in Uttarakhand, met Shiv Sena (UBT) leader Uddhav Thackeray on Monday, expressing sympathy for Thackeray's betrayal and suggesting that Maharashtra's pain will persist until he becomes chief minister again. The seer criticized the betrayal as a sin and questioned the recent foundation stone laying of a Kedarnath temple in Delhi by Uttarakhand's chief minister.

    PM Modi stresses on need for education based on Indian values

    Prime Minister Narendra Modi emphasized the importance of an education system rooted in Indian values during a virtual address commemorating the 200th birth anniversary of Arya Samaj founder Swami Dayanand Saraswati. He highlighted Swami Dayanand's efforts to address social evils and orthodoxy, which were exploited by British rulers to tarnish Hindu society. PM Modi praised Swami Dayanand's advocacy for gender equality and underscored the role of Arya Samaj schools in promoting Indian values. He expressed pride in being born in Gujarat, Swami Dayanand's birthplace.
